HOW TO GET HIRED AS A STRATEGY CONSULTANT

Strategy consulting is a highly sought-after and competitive field, offering intellectually stimulating work, exposure to diverse industries, and the opportunity to make a significant impact on organizations. However, breaking into this prestigious domain requires a combination of academic excellence, professional experience, and a well-crafted approach.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you navigate the path to becoming a strategy consultant.

  1. Pursue a Relevant Education Strategy consulting firms heavily favor candidates with exceptional academic credentials. Earning a degree from a top-tier university, preferably in fields like business, economics, engineering, or mathematics, can give you a competitive edge. Additionally, many aspiring consultants opt to pursue advanced degrees, such as an MBA or a master’s in a specialized field, to further enhance their qualifications.
  2. Gain Relevant Work Experience While academic achievements are crucial, practical experience is equally valued in the strategy consulting world. Seek out internships, participate in case competitions, or take on project-based roles that allow you to develop skills in problem-solving, data analysis, and client management. Relevant work experience not only demonstrates your capabilities but also provides valuable insights into the consulting industry.
  3. Refine Your Analytical and Communication Skills Strategy consulting firms place a premium on candidates with exceptional analytical and communication skills. Develop proficiency in data analysis, problem-solving, and critical thinking. Additionally, hone your presentation and communication abilities, as you’ll need to articulate complex ideas effectively to clients and stakeholders.
  4. Network and Build Relationships Networking is essential in the consulting industry. Attend industry events, connect with current consultants, and leverage your university’s alumni network. Building relationships with professionals in the field can provide valuable insights, mentorship opportunities, and potential job leads.
  5. Prepare for the Recruitment Process The recruitment process for strategy consulting firms is notoriously rigorous. Familiarize yourself with the typical case interview format, practice case studies, and be prepared to showcase your problem-solving abilities under pressure. Additionally, research the firms you’re interested in and tailor your application materials to highlight your fit with their culture and values.
  6. Showcase Your Passion and Commitment Strategy consulting is a demanding profession that requires a strong work ethic and unwavering commitment. During the interview process, demonstrate your passion for the field, your willingness to tackle complex challenges, and your ability to thrive in a fast-paced, client-focused environment.
